Chicken nachos - Oh so easy!

I have made this recipe twice, in quick succession, it's just so easy to make and even easier to eat! A huge plus also, is that it's more of an assembly job than a recipe. Here is what you will need: 2-3 packets of tortilla chips 2 cooked, skinless chicken beasts 1/2 small jar of sliced red or green jalapeno peppers 3-6 small, sliced spring onions 140g red leicester cheese to serve: sour cream, guacamole, salsa.... Spread the tortilla chips over the base of an oven proof dish, as you can see from the photograph I used a glass pyrex dish. Place the chicken which has been shredded into bite size pieces over the top of the tortilla chips, then put the jalapenos, spring onions and the cheese (which has been grated) over the top. Cook for about 10 minutes in a moderate oven until the cheese has melted and the chicken has heated through. Serve with the usual Mexican fixings...and DIG IN!
